Executing Unix script in Execute stage of Sequence

Posted: Fri Oct 12, 2012 2:15 pm
by vishu19aug
Hi,

I am using the 'execute stage' of sequence and running a invoking a shell script in this. The script failed -
xxxx_Trend..JobControl (@execute_send_mail_script): Executed: /opt/app/abc.sh "vg189d@xx,com" "11-OCT-2012" "04-aug-2012" "27-aug-2012" "20-SEP-2012"
Reply=127
Output from command ====>
SH: /opt/app/abc.sh: No such file or directory

but still the sequence said -
11:56:51: execute_send_mail_script finished, reply=127
11:56:51: Sequence finished OK

How can the error be captured in sequence? Please help

Thanks,
Vishal

Posted: Fri Oct 12, 2012 3:09 pm
by chulett
Sure, that can be handled by a specific trigger from the stage to your failure processing or you can enable "Automatically handle activities that fail" in the Sequence.
